What are HS Codes?

Before diving into the specific codes for power meters, let’s briefly review what HS codes are and why they matter:

The Harmonized System (HS) is an international nomenclature developed by the World Customs Organization (WCO) for the classification of goods. It comprises about 5,000 commodity groups, each identified by a six-digit code. The HS is used by more than 200 countries as a basis for their customs tariffs and for the collection of international trade statistics.

Key points about HS codes:

  • They provide a universal “language” for classifying traded products
  • The first 6 digits are standard worldwide, while countries can add additional digits for further specificity
  • Proper classification ensures correct duty rates and compliance with trade regulations
  • They facilitate the collection of trade statistics and economic analysis


HS Codes for Power Meters

Power meters, including electricity meters, energy monitors, and power consumption devices, generally fall under Chapter 90 of the Harmonized System, which covers “Optical, photographic, cinematographic, measuring, checking, precision, medical or surgical instruments and apparatus; parts and accessories thereof.”

The specific 6-digit HS code for most power meters is:

902830 – Electricity meters, including calibrating meters therefor

This classification includes various types of electricity meters used for measuring electrical energy consumption in residential, commercial, and industrial applications.



Subcategories and Further Classifications

While the 6-digit code 902830 is universally recognized, many countries add additional digits for more specific classifications. For example:

  • 9028.30.10 – Electromechanical electricity meters (in some countries)
  • 9028.30.20 – Electronic electricity meters (in some countries)
  • 9028.30.90 – Other electricity meters (in some countries)

It’s important to note that these extended classifications may vary between countries, so always verify the specific requirements for your target market.



Related HS Codes

While 902830 is the primary code for power meters, there are related codes that might be relevant depending on the specific type of device or its components:

  • 9028.90 – Parts and accessories for electricity meters
  • 9030.31 – Multimeters without a recording device
  • 9030.32 – Multimeters with a recording device
  • 9030.39 – Other instruments and apparatus for measuring or checking electrical quantities, without a recording device
  • 9030.89 – Other instruments and apparatus for measuring or checking electrical quantities, with a recording device


Importance of Correct HS Code Classification

Proper classification of power meters under the correct HS code is crucial for several reasons:

  1. Duty Rates: The HS code determines the applicable import duties and taxes.
  2. Trade Agreements: Preferential tariff treatments under free trade agreements often depend on the HS code.
  3. Import/Export Controls: Certain products may be subject to specific regulations or restrictions based on their HS code.
  4. Statistics: Accurate classification contributes to reliable international trade statistics.
  5. Compliance: Using the correct HS code ensures compliance with customs regulations and avoids potential penalties.


Challenges in Classifying Power Meters

While the general classification for power meters is straightforward, challenges can arise due to technological advancements and the increasing complexity of these devices. Some potential issues include:

  • Smart Meters: Advanced meters with communication capabilities may require careful consideration to determine if they should be classified under 902830 or a different category.
  • Multifunctional Devices: Meters that measure multiple utilities (e.g., electricity, gas, and water) may need special consideration.
  • Component Classification: When importing or exporting parts of power meters, determining whether to use the parts-specific code (9028.90) or a more general electrical components code can be challenging.
